25 years ago today: OU beat No. 1 Nebraska in arguably the loudest game ever played at Owen Field.
The Sooners rallied from a 14-0 deficit to win 31-14 and the win ended a Red October run of wins over No. 11 Texas, No. 2 Kansas State and No. 1 Nebraska.
